AFB International, headquartered in the United States, is a leading provider of flavour and palatability solutions for the pet food and animal nutrition industries. Founded in 1982, the company has established a strong presence in key operational regions, including North America, Europe, and Asia. Specialising in the development of innovative flavouring systems, AFB International offers a unique range of products designed to enhance the taste and appeal of pet food, ensuring optimal nutrition and consumer satisfaction. With a commitment to quality and sustainability, the company has achieved notable milestones, including significant advancements in flavour technology and a robust portfolio of patented formulations. Recognised for its market leadership, AFB International continues to set industry standards, making it a trusted partner for pet food manufacturers worldwide.
